/external/mesa3d/src/mesa/drivers/dri/nouveau/ |
D | nouveau_vbo_t.c | 43 get_array_stride(struct gl_context *ctx, const struct gl_vertex_array *a) in get_array_stride() 56 const struct gl_vertex_array **arrays) in vbo_init_arrays() 77 const struct gl_vertex_array *array = arrays[attr]; in vbo_init_arrays() 89 const struct gl_vertex_array **arrays) in vbo_deinit_arrays() 113 vbo_choose_render_mode(struct gl_context *ctx, const struct gl_vertex_array **arrays) in vbo_choose_render_mode() 131 vbo_emit_attr(struct gl_context *ctx, const struct gl_vertex_array **arrays, in vbo_emit_attr() 136 const struct gl_vertex_array *array = arrays[attr]; in vbo_emit_attr() 171 vbo_choose_attrs(struct gl_context *ctx, const struct gl_vertex_array **arrays) in vbo_choose_attrs() 214 get_max_client_stride(struct gl_context *ctx, const struct gl_vertex_array **arrays) in get_max_client_stride() 220 const struct gl_vertex_array *a = arrays[attr]; in get_max_client_stride() [all …]
|
/external/mesa3d/src/mesa/vbo/ |
D | vbo_rebase.c | 82 GLboolean vbo_all_varyings_in_vbos( const struct gl_vertex_array *arrays[] ) in REBASE() 94 GLboolean vbo_any_varyings_in_vbos( const struct gl_vertex_array *arrays[] ) in vbo_any_varyings_in_vbos() 125 const struct gl_vertex_array *arrays[], in vbo_rebase_prims() 133 struct gl_vertex_array tmp_arrays[VERT_ATTRIB_MAX]; in vbo_rebase_prims() 134 const struct gl_vertex_array *tmp_array_pointers[VERT_ATTRIB_MAX]; in vbo_rebase_prims() 138 const struct gl_vertex_array **saved_arrays = ctx->Array._DrawArrays; in vbo_rebase_prims()
|
D | vbo_split_copy.c | 54 const struct gl_vertex_array **array; 65 const struct gl_vertex_array *array; 68 struct gl_vertex_array dstarray; 73 const struct gl_vertex_array *dstarray_ptr[VERT_ATTRIB_MAX]; 106 attr_size(const struct gl_vertex_array *array) in attr_size() 142 const struct gl_vertex_array **arrays, in dump_draw_info() 176 const struct gl_vertex_array **saved_arrays = ctx->Array._DrawArrays; in flush() 256 const struct gl_vertex_array *srcarray = copy->varying[i].array; in elt() 512 const struct gl_vertex_array *src = copy->varying[i].array; in replay_init() 513 struct gl_vertex_array *dst = ©->varying[i].dstarray; in replay_init() [all …]
|
D | vbo.h | 42 struct gl_vertex_array; 141 const struct gl_vertex_array *arrays[], 153 GLboolean vbo_all_varyings_in_vbos( const struct gl_vertex_array *arrays[] ); 154 GLboolean vbo_any_varyings_in_vbos( const struct gl_vertex_array *arrays[] ); 157 const struct gl_vertex_array *arrays[],
|
D | vbo_exec.h | 112 struct gl_vertex_array arrays[VERT_ATTRIB_MAX]; 118 const struct gl_vertex_array *inputs[VERT_ATTRIB_MAX]; 132 const struct gl_vertex_array *inputs[VERT_ATTRIB_MAX];
|
D | vbo_save.c | 49 struct gl_vertex_array *arrays = save->arrays; in vbo_save_init() 55 struct gl_vertex_array *array; in vbo_save_init() 67 struct gl_vertex_array *array; in vbo_save_init()
|
D | vbo_context.c | 52 init_array(struct gl_context *ctx, struct gl_vertex_array *cl, in init_array() 83 struct gl_vertex_array *cl = &vbo->currval[VERT_ATTRIB_FF(i)]; in init_legacy_currval() 99 struct gl_vertex_array *cl = &vbo->currval[VBO_ATTRIB_GENERIC0 + i]; in init_generic_currval() 116 struct gl_vertex_array *cl = in init_mat_currval()
|
D | vbo_split.h | 53 const struct gl_vertex_array *arrays[], 65 const struct gl_vertex_array *arrays[],
|
D | vbo_save.h | 142 struct gl_vertex_array arrays[VBO_ATTRIB_MAX]; 143 const struct gl_vertex_array *inputs[VBO_ATTRIB_MAX];
|
D | vbo_split_inplace.c | 45 const struct gl_vertex_array **array; 66 const struct gl_vertex_array **saved_arrays = ctx->Array._DrawArrays; in flush_vertex() 265 const struct gl_vertex_array *arrays[], in vbo_split_inplace()
|
D | vbo_split.c | 102 const struct gl_vertex_array *arrays[], in vbo_split_prims()
|
D | vbo_save_draw.c | 138 struct gl_vertex_array *arrays = save->arrays; in bind_vertex_list() 204 struct gl_vertex_array *array = &arrays[attr]; in bind_vertex_list()
|
D | vbo_context.h | 67 struct gl_vertex_array currval[VBO_ATTRIB_MAX];
|
D | vbo_exec_api.c | 1199 struct gl_vertex_array *arrays = exec->vtx.arrays; in vbo_exec_vtx_init() 1205 struct gl_vertex_array *array; in vbo_exec_vtx_init() 1217 struct gl_vertex_array *array; in vbo_exec_vtx_init()
|
/external/mesa3d/src/mesa/state_tracker/ |
D | st_atom_array.c | 303 static const struct gl_vertex_array * 304 get_client_array(const struct gl_vertex_array **arrays, in get_client_array() 319 const struct gl_vertex_array **arrays, in is_interleaved_arrays() 329 const struct gl_vertex_array *array; in is_interleaved_arrays() 457 const struct gl_vertex_array **arrays, in setup_interleaved_attribs() 472 const struct gl_vertex_array *array; in setup_interleaved_attribs() 506 const struct gl_vertex_array *array; in setup_interleaved_attribs() 576 const struct gl_vertex_array **arrays, in setup_non_interleaved_attribs() 588 const struct gl_vertex_array *array; in setup_non_interleaved_attribs() 689 const struct gl_vertex_array **arrays = ctx->Array._DrawArrays; in st_update_array()
|
D | st_cb_rasterpos.c | 63 struct gl_vertex_array array[VERT_ATTRIB_MAX]; 64 const struct gl_vertex_array *arrays[VERT_ATTRIB_MAX]; 225 const struct gl_vertex_array **saved_arrays = ctx->Array._DrawArrays; in st_RasterPos()
|
D | st_draw.h | 41 struct gl_vertex_array;
|
D | st_atom.c | 141 const struct gl_vertex_array **arrays = st->ctx->Array._DrawArrays; in check_attrib_edgeflag()
|
D | st_draw_feedback.c | 133 const struct gl_vertex_array **arrays = ctx->Array._DrawArrays; in st_feedback_draw_vbo()
|
/external/mesa3d/src/mesa/tnl/ |
D | t_draw.c | 98 convert_bgra_to_float(const struct gl_vertex_array *input, in convert_bgra_to_float() 116 convert_half_to_float(const struct gl_vertex_array *input, in convert_half_to_float() 143 convert_fixed_to_float(const struct gl_vertex_array *input, in convert_fixed_to_float() 176 const struct gl_vertex_array *input, in _tnl_import_array() 270 const struct gl_vertex_array *inputs[], in bind_inputs() 433 const struct gl_vertex_array **arrays = ctx->Array._DrawArrays; in _tnl_draw_prims()
|
D | tnl.h | 33 struct gl_vertex_array;
|
/external/mesa3d/src/mesa/main/ |
D | varray.h | 34 struct gl_vertex_array; 58 struct gl_vertex_array *dst, in _mesa_update_client_array() 463 struct gl_vertex_array *dst, 464 struct gl_vertex_array *src);
|
/external/mesa3d/src/mesa/drivers/dri/i965/ |
D | brw_draw_upload.c | 252 const struct gl_vertex_array *glarray) in brw_get_vertex_surface_type() 516 const struct gl_vertex_array *glarray = input->glarray; in brw_prepare_vertices() 548 const struct gl_vertex_array *other = brw->vb.enabled[k]->glarray; in brw_prepare_vertices()
|
D | brw_draw.c | 280 const struct gl_vertex_array *arrays[]) in brw_merge_inputs() 694 const struct gl_vertex_array *arrays[], in brw_prepare_drawing() 781 const struct gl_vertex_array *arrays[], in brw_draw_single_prim() 928 const struct gl_vertex_array **arrays = ctx->Array._DrawArrays; in brw_draw_prims()
|
D | brw_context.h | 440 const struct gl_vertex_array *glarray; 1455 const struct gl_vertex_array *glarray);
|